Smugglers’ violent attack on police in Birgunj reveals security lapses
Summary
A violent attack by smugglers on police during a customs raid in Birgunj highlights significant security lapses and challenges in controlling illegal cross-border smuggling activities.
Key Points
- Customs and Armed Police conducted a raid on a shop involved in smuggling goods from India in Birgunj's Adarshanagar area.
- During the seizure of smuggled goods worth Rs 1.275 million, a mob attacked police personnel injuring three officers.
- Eight people have been arrested, including the shop operator, while the alleged mastermind remains absconding with 21 individuals under investigation.
- Authorities have increased border security and patrols after the attack, stressing ongoing challenges in curbing illegal cross-border smuggling.
